Established lowset house on level block | mixed street character with unit and detached stock | strong digital connectivity and local amenity | practical family or investor configuration | mid-market Taree positioning The property sits within a well-settled residential street where older brick-and-tile houses and villa-style units coexist, giving it a functional rather than premium character. Its likely single-level layout on a moderate lot suits first-home buyers, downsizers, or small families seeking convenience over prestige. The area’s proximity to schools, shops, sporting facilities, and the Manning River precinct adds everyday practicality, while the mix of housing types supports steady demand from both owner-occupiers and investors. This is not a standout architectural property, but its utility and location make it a dependable choice for those prioritising access and low-maintenance living. Value may be shaped by the property’s age and condition relative to newer stock, as well as its exact land size and any updates to kitchen, bathroom, or flooring. The presence of older character finishes, such as timber floors or high ceilings, could either add charm or signal deferred maintenance, depending on their state. The street’s mixed density might also influence perceived appeal—some buyers prefer uniform house streets, while others value the flexibility of nearby unit stock. These factors could widen or narrow the price range, so a careful inspection of the building’s structure and fit-out is advisable.
